Comfortable Seating The seat on a four wheel electric scooter for adults is an essential aspect of your comfort. You should choose one with armrests and a headrest that can be adjusted and padding for the backrest. The seat should also rotate and allow you to move around obstacles. Some models have an armrest that can be turned up, allowing the rider to stand up without having to remove the seat of their scooter. The type of brake system is also important. Some brakes are electronic, while others have hydraulic brakes. The latter are preferred as they offer greater precision in stopping power and require less maintenance. They are also better for use on terrain that is rough because they are able to handle sudden stops and turns. Consider the maximum weight of the scooter. To ensure the scooter is safe and stable it is important to remain within this limit. In addition, overstepping the weight limit recommended by the manufacturer will result in the scooter performing poorly and run out of battery power quickly. It is also important to weigh any personal items or equipment that you may need to carry on your scooter. If you are planning to travel for long distances, it is vital to select a model that has a large range and speed. This will allow you travel for longer distances without having to stop to recharge the battery. You may also want to consider a scooter which can be easily disassembled into four pieces and transported inside the trunk of a standard-sized car. Check the warranty and customer support of the scooter, in addition to the features listed above. This will assist you in addressing any issues that may arise after purchase. It is also important to consider the brand's reputation and reviews to get a better understanding of the quality and performance of the product. Easy to Operate Four wheel electric scooters provide greater stability and security as compared to three-wheel mobility models, particularly for people with limited balance or mobility. Four-wheeled scooters are typically constructed with a larger seating area and platform for maximum comfort. Additionally, a four-wheeled mobility scooter is able to handle a variety of terrain and can handle slightly rough surfaces like parks or sidewalks. This allows people to explore their environment and maintain an active lifestyle. When choosing the ideal 4-wheel scooter, you should consider things such as: Weight Capacity - Check the scooter's weight limit to make sure it's able to handle your body's shape, as well as any additional equipment or accessories you might require for daily use. You should also take into consideration the scooter's overall size and dimensions to ensure that it will fit through tight spaces and doors. Battery Life and Range: Examine the mobility scooter’s battery power. Check that it is able to cover the distances you need to travel on a regular bases without running out. Check the scooter's top speeds and acceleration capabilities to ensure they are compatible with your preferred driving style. Maneuverability: Take a look at the mobility scooter’s turn radius and its maneuverability to determine whether it is suitable for your environment. If you reside in an urban area with a lot of traffic and narrow streets, for example, then it is best to select an electric scooter with a smaller turning radius so that you can navigate these narrow spaces with ease. In addition, a good 4-wheel scooter will have a simple to operate controls that are easy to operate and comprehend. The control panel on the scooter will have an accelerator lever, a brake lever and indicator light that are all easily accessible so that you can ride your mobility scooter with confidence. The joystick on the scooter is often also conveniently located for effortless operation and smooth riding. The swivel-seat is another excellent feature that can be easily adjusted in height and angle to help you to get on and off the scooter without difficulty.
